#28149c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#28149c is composed of 15.7% red, 7.8%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.4% cyan, 87.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 248.8 degrees, a saturation of 77.3% and a lightness of 34.5%. #28149c color hex could be obtained by blending #5028ff with #000039.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#28149c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040211 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#28149c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585858 is the less saturated color, while #1e06aa is the most saturated one.
